In 2001 I worked for a startup that developed a chat application for Brazil that got pretty big. Amazingly we sent out about 20,000 unsolicited emails and got close to 10,000 signups, probably the best response to an email campaign I’ve ever seen and not something we were able to repeat, particularly when we got crappy lists where some of the addresses didn’t even have an “@“ sign in it.
